Output 592a87b6daaf95b303590ef94de0159d6ab400eb605ed36e004023fd06e54460:0

value
647051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de326e0c1cf6f7de9e05db16c24e8e4045053f50 OP_EQUAL
address
3MwtM4NwsHmHm2111eQRQbAmH3FxkB7bej
transaction
592a87b6daaf95b303590ef94de0159d6ab400eb605ed36e004023fd06e54460
confirmations
287526
spent
true